The Core Dynamic
Dragon and Horse share a productive element relationship — one nourishes the other in the Five Elements creative cycle. This is one of the most generative compatibility patterns in BaZi. Your energies feed each other rather than compete. The work is making sure the giving flows both directions over time.
Horse's Fire naturally produces Dragon's Earth in the Five Elements cycle. Horse tends to be the nourishing presence — feeding Dragon's drive and creativity. The challenge is making sure the support flows both ways over time.
Strengths of This Pairing
Dragon's visionary and commanding nature pairs with Horse's energetic and free-spirited nature to create a balanced public presence.
Element production means your energies feed rather than drain each other when the relationship is healthy.
You're likely to grow visibly during the relationship — friends will notice positive changes in both of you.
Challenges to Watch
Dragon can be controlling, prideful, or impatient with smaller minds. Horse can be inconsistent, attention-seeking, or commitment-shy. When stress hits, both shadows can surface together.
Productive cycles can become one-directional — one partner gives, the other receives, and the imbalance accumulates.
The giving partner can quietly burn out if their own needs are not regularly met.
These challenges describe the general Dragon–Horse year-animal pattern — not your specific relationship. Whether they're a real risk depends on both of your Day Masters, which are unique to each person's birth date.
